So today I'm sharing my scrapbook layout from when we said goodbye to our own girl, Sadie, nearly four years ago when she was 14 years old.


Man, this was a tough layout to make, but I am glad I have it for my furbabies' scrapbook.  The two pictures on the bottom right were taken just two days before Sadie passed.  I chose that multicolored washy background because it reminded me of a low-key Rainbow Bridge for my girl.  I miss her and Vader still every day, but we are looking forward to adopting a dog or two after we move again this summer.  I miss having furbabies.


I used black for my page base, Cherry Cobbler to match Sadie's collar, and the other colors are in the watercolor wash background, Misty Moonlight, Blushing Bride, and So Saffron.

Supplies, all SU!
Stamps:  Back to Basics Alphabet, Happy Tails
Ink:  Memento Tuxedo Black, Misty Moonlight, Basic Black marker
Paper:  Basic Black, Cherry Cobbler, Misty Moonlight, Thick Basic White, Sand & Sea DSP
Accessories:  Dog Builder Punch
